The interior is looking really tatty so that's my next job. I'd appreciate any advice I can get on sorting it out...

1. Dash Panel with 'Elise' wrote on it


Sadly the paint has been chipped off and is flaking above the radio.
Can this be repainted? If so what is the code? Where can i get the paint from?
...or where can I buy a new panel from? I've searched on all the elise part internet shops, but with no luck!

2. The Floor

It's looking really faded and discoloured. Any secrets for bringing the colour back to it?

3. The Seats


They're all scuffed and large 'grey' areas are visible where they should be black. Are there any leather treatment products to 'liven them up' also?

4. The Seat Rails

5 years sat in a barn have not been kind to it and the rails etc. have a layer of rust on them. I want to remove them and repaint them.
- is it easy to remove the seats? Do I have to go under the car?
- What is the best paint to use?

5. The Chassis

It's all scuffed and marked and I can't seem to wash off the shoe sole scuff marks.
I recall reading some tips on how to do this years ago... does anyone have a link/ that info?

For the floor and chassis, magic sponges (jml or others are available) are the way so go, seats, are easy to remove, I had one of mine out the other day to install a new runner, to remove the seat from the runners it is just a case of 2 nuts and some Allen head bolts.

Re your scuffs you an get some dye but I tend to just use a sharpie marker pen, re the dash part, sorry I do not think lotus released a paint code for it, most people either paint them to match the car or wrap them
